Main objective of the trial |
To study, in hypertensive patients, followed in general practice and whose Blood Pressure is well controlled by a monotherapy with tablets of perindopril arginine, their preference and acceptability in favour of the orodispersible form of this medicinal product 1 month after changing the dosage form.

End point title |
Preference for orodispersible versus tablet perindopril arginine form at one month [1] | ||||||
End point description |
5 questions were included in the questionnaire that was filled in after one month after patient's inclusion
- Question 1 : Preference for orodispersible form (versus tablet) ?
- Question 2: Is orodispersible form the most convenient ?
- Question 3 : Is orodispersible form the most appropriate ?
- Question 4: Would you use orodispersible form for a long treatment period ?
- Question 5 : Would you use orodispersible form for the further 2 months ?
As no statistical analysis of the questionnaire was conducted due to the low number of patients included in the study, the endpoint described hereafter correspond to the answer to the question 1. Of note the same score was obtained for question 2, 3, 4, and at question 5 all patients responded that they would use for further 2 months the orodispersible perindopril arginine form.

Notes [1] - No statistical analyses have been specified for this primary end point. It is expected there is at least one statistical analysis for each primary end point. Justification: A low number of patients could be included in the study (n = 12) compared to the number planned (n = 100), due to difficulty to recruit patients that led to premature study discontinuation. Therefore it had been decided to not carry out statistical analysis of the questionnaires. |

Notes [1] - There are no non-serious adverse events recorded for these results. It is expected that there will be at least one non-serious adverse event reported. Justification: This study was conducted in very few patients, followed by their doctor, for whom the arterial hypertension was well controlled with perindopril arginine 5 or 10 mg per day administered as tablet for at least 3 months. In the Preference study patients switched from this background therapy to the same product same dose but with an orodispersible form, on a short duration. None of the patients reported as medical history co-morbidities. It is probably why no non-serious adverse event occurred. |
